Assessing Your Energy Demands and Goals
Exactly how can you establish the ideal solar remedy for your home? Begin by examining your current energy intake. Take a look at your utility expenses over the past year to identify patterns in usage.
Next, consider your objectives. Do you want to reduce your power expenses, increase power freedom, or reduce your carbon footprint?
Once you've determined your objectives, think of your home's details characteristics, like its roof covering size and alignment. This'll help you estimate how much solar energy you can harness.
Additionally, factor in future power needs, such as potential home expansions or the addition of electric lorries.
Picking the Right Solar System
When it pertains to selecting the best planetary system for your home, where do you begin? First, consider your power requires. Review your previous utility bills to establish just how much power you eat.
Next, consider the system kind that suits your way of life: grid-tied, off-grid, or crossbreed. Grid-tied systems are prominent for their cost-effectiveness, while off-grid systems supply freedom.
Then, review the solar panel types-- monocrystalline, polycrystalline, or thin-film-- based upon performance and spending plan.
Do not forget to consider your roofing system's orientation and shading, as these affect system efficiency.
